  3. Moving OEM windows 10 to new build

    Under the terms of the Windows 10 OEM license agreement, no, but you could try phone activation as a work around/loophole. It has worked.

    OEM versions of Windows 10 are identical to Full License Retail versions except for the following:

    - OEM versions do not offer any free Microsoft direct support from Microsoft support personnel

    - OEM licenses are tied to the very first computer you install and activate it on

    - OEM versions allow all hardware upgrades except for an upgrade to a different model motherboard

    - OEM versions cannot be used to directly upgrade from an older Windows operating system

    1. Press Windows key + X then clickRun, then type:
    slui.exe 4

    2. Next press the 'ENTER' key

    3. Select your 'Country' from the list.

    4. Choose the 'Phone Activation' option.

    5. Stay on the phone (do not select/press any options) and wait for a person to help you with activation.

    6. Explain your problem clearly to the support person.

  6. Yes, Windows 10 uses a different type of OEM activation from what Windows 7 used. No SLIC table, it uses an embedded key instead. All (official) Windows 10 install media, OEM or Retail, looks for and will use OEM embedded keys automatically. Branded (HP, Dell, etc) OEM install media likely has OEM branding in it, and maybe some other customizations, if obtained from Dell, etc. I wouldn't expect it to come with a Product key. The assumption is its embedded in the PC's BIOS. That's my understanding anyway. Regular (system builder) OEM install media from new Egg etc, won't have anything extra added. Assuming you can buy system builder OEM install media for Windows 10. OEM system builder install media should come with a product key.

  10. lx07 Win User
    "They" do not embed any key in the DVD. It doesn't work like that. You activate an edition with the correct key. A key from another edition doesn't work.

    Are you saying you installed Pro N and your key is for Pro?

    If so your key is for the wrong edition. Same as if you installed Pro and tried to put in a home key.

    Assuming that that is the case, unless you want to try to change your installed edition, you need to install Pro (not Pro N) and try again.
